Etymology
The spelling of Elizabeth used in the Authorized Version of the New Testament. From the Greek �λι�αβε� (Elisabet), a transliteration of the Hebrew �ֱ�ִ�שֶ��ַע ('Elisheva), meaning my God is an oath''.
